問題タブ [service-not-available]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- C2DMSERVICE_NOT_AVAILABLE登録時のエラー
これが私のコードです:
登録時にSERVICE_NOT_AVAILABLEエラーが発生しますが、これは何が原因でしょうか?これはアクティビティです。
java - c2dmの使用中にSERVICE_NOT_AVAILABLEエラーが発生しました
C2DMを機能させようとしています。ここでは、ChrometoPhoneの例に従っています。
エミュレーターがC2DMに登録しようとすると、が表示されますSERVICE_NOT_AVAILABLE
。エミュレーターにGmailアカウントが設定されており、サンプルコードと同じアカウントが渡されsenderId
ていることを確認しました。DeviceRegistrar.java
また、エミュレーターがインターネットにアクセスでき、すべてのアクセス許可(インターネットへのアクセス、ウェイクロックなど)を持っていることも確信しています。ここで他に何が間違っている可能性がありますか?
問題をうまく説明できたかどうかはわかりません。他に説明が必要な場合はお知らせください。
ここはC2DMBaseReceiver.java
C2DMBroadcastReceiver.java
C2DMessaging.java
C2DMReceiver.java
DeviceRegistrar.java
マニフェスト:
返されるエラーはSERVICE_NOT_AVAILABLE
私の主な活動では、これを行っています:
android - C2DM で SERVICE_NOT_AVAILABLE
C2DM に登録しようとすると、SERVICE_NOT_AVAILABLE
エラーが発生することがあります。このエラーが発生したときにgoogletochromeアプリケーションで提供されたコードを使用しました。再試行の回数と、再試行後に登録される可能性を尋ねたいだけです。より良い代替手段はありますか?
android - Google クラウド メッセージング - GCM - SERVICE_NOT_AVAILABLE
私は、新しい GCM を実装しようとしています 。
デバイス登録 ID の取得で行き詰まりました。
私のアプリはGoogleサーバーに接続しようとし続けます.ここに私のエラーログがあります:
ID を要求する私のアクティビティ コードは次のとおりです。
ここに私のサービスコード
そして、ここに私のAndroidマニフェストがあります:
私は Google の指示に従っていますが、この SERVICE_NOT_AVAILABLE エラーに固執しました。
私は何を間違っていますか?
android - 新しい GCM クライアント サンプルでのみエラー SERVICE_NOT_AVAILABLE
ライブラリからClass を使用する新しいGCM クライアント サンプルをダウンロードして実装しました。エラーが発生します。jar ファイルが最後のバージョンであることはわかっています。エラーに関するすべての投稿を調べましたが、解決できませんでした。GoogleCloudMessaging
google-play-services.jar
SERVICE_NOT_AVAILABLE
SERVICE_NOT_AVAILABLE
次に、 を使用する古いGCM クライアント サンプルをテストしましたgcm.jar
。デバイスを正常に登録でき、登録 ID を取得できました。これら 2 つのアプリケーションのパッケージ名は同じだったので、新しいサンプルでその登録 ID を使用でき、アプリケーションは正常に動作し、メッセージを正常に取得できました。
これで、新しいGCM クライアント サンプルのエラーは、Wi-Fi やファイアウォール、または…に関するものではないこと がわかりました。</p>
今、私は本当の問題が何であるかを知りたいです。2 つのプロジェクトのマニフェストは同じで、両方のマニフェストで必要な権限をすべて持っています。
私は今どうすればいい?どうすれば問題を解決できますか?
android - リバース ジオコーディング - サービスが利用できません - デバイスを再起動しても解決しない - 手動の逆ジオコーディングを批判する
Service Not Available
ときどき、アプリケーションで例外に該当します。ほとんどの場合、問題はありません。しかし、時々それが起こります。(アプリはまだ開発中です)
それを解決する唯一の方法は、ハンドセットを再起動することです。サポート フォーラムの関連する Issue38009。しかし、コメントから私が理解しているのは、デバイスを再起動すると問題が永遠に解決するということです。
これは正しいです?
私の場合、バグが再発する可能性があるためです(頻度:月に1〜2回だと思いますが、このアプリでフルタイムです)。
アプリケーション内からジオコーダーを再起動する方法はありますか?
私が持っている唯一の解決策は、以下のように「手動で」アドレスを取得する場合に備えて、別の解決策を提供することです。他に良いものはありますか?